Output 23c106c443b729653a728bbb3cf7bec6740bce63da1e59b6945d7b21de9dfb9e:0

value
29440119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24fb34b8439c02acdce0fc9ec6c0eec624e2bb4e OP_EQUAL
address
MBGhVRvdZBMN3WkQ1uTkCcqBu2XrGS4gWj
transaction
23c106c443b729653a728bbb3cf7bec6740bce63da1e59b6945d7b21de9dfb9e
spent
true